请定义一个交通工具(Vehicle)类
其中有属性:
速度speed
体积size
方法移动move()
设置速度setSpeed(int speed)
加速speedUp()
减速speedDown()
最后在测试类Vehicle中的main() 中实例化一个交通工具对象,并通过方法给它初始化speed,size的值并且打印出来,另外调用加速减速的方法对速度进行改变
搭建大体框架:
/**
* @author LBJ
* @version V1.0
* @Package PACKAGE_NAME
* @date 2021/1/28 17:38
* @Copyright 公司
*/
/*
请定义一个交通工具(Vehicle)类
其中有属性:
速度speed
体积size
方法移动move()
设置速度setSpeed(int speed)
加速speedUp()
减速speedDown()
最后在测试类Vehicle中的main() 中实例化一个交通工具对象,并通过方法给它初始化speed,size的值并且打印出来,另外调用加速减速的方法对速度进行改变
*/
public class Test01{
public static void main(String[] args) {
//通过无参数构造方法创建对象
Vehicle vehicle = new Vehicle();
vehicle.setSpeed(100);
vehicle.setSize(20);
System.out.println("speed:"+vehicle.getSpeed());
System.out.println("size:"+vehicle.getSize());
//调用加速方法
vehicle.speedUp();
System.out.println(vehicle.getSpeed());
//调用减速方法
vehicle.speedDown();
System.out.println(vehicle.getSpeed());
//通过有参数构造方法创建对象
//Vehicle vehicle1 = new Vehicle(100, 20);
}
}
class Vehicle {
private int speed;
private int size;
public Vehicle(){
}
public Vehicle(int speed,int size){
this.speed=speed;
this.size=size;
}
public int getSpeed() {
return speed;
}
public void setSpeed(int speed) {
this.speed = speed;